Magento 2.4.7-p4 : Ui listing inline edit not working when multiple tables on same page #39657

Preconditions and environment

  • Magento version 2.4.7 ( including all patch versions )

Steps to reproduce

  • Create a custom admin ui_form
  • Add two insertListings to the form
  • Both listings should have inline edit enabled

Expected result

Both tables should have the rows editable

Actual result

Only the first rendered table is editable , the second table rendered on clicking a row to edit the entire table is greyed out without being able to edit the selected row

Additional information

Retested back with 2.4.6-p9 and everything works as intended so the bug was introduced in the 2.4.7 branch
